Creating a Dynamic Effect with Fewer Particles in Unreal Engine 5 Niagara
Description: In this tutorial, Ashif Ali demonstrates how to achieve a dynamic particle effect using just five particles while maintaining a full, rich look. Instead of using a large number of particles, this technique leverages materials and textures to create the appearance of multiple particles in motion. By utilizing specific material functions and Photoshop to create randomized textures, you can simulate the look of a more complex system with fewer resources. This is a great method to optimize performance without compromising the visual quality of your effect. Let’s dive into how to achieve this in Unreal Engine 5’s Niagara system.
Key Notes:
- Start with a basic Niagara particle system: Begin by using the “Fountain” emitter to create a set of particles. Adjust the velocity, gravity, and sphere render size to achieve your desired look.
- Reduce the number of particles: Instead of using many particles, limit the number to 5 for a lighter effect while keeping the look consistent with a more particle-dense system.
- Create custom textures in Photoshop: Use Photoshop to design a randomized texture with a few white pixels spread across a black canvas. Offset and noise the pattern to add variety and create a more natural effect.
- Use the ‘Chaos Normal From Heightmap’ function: This function adds randomized motion to your texture, simulating the effect of many particles moving in different directions without having to manually replicate multiple particles.
- Apply this texture to a material: Set the material to unlit, two-sided, and connect it to the particle system. Use radial and alpha operations to fine-tune the appearance.
- Adjust particle settings: Increase the particle size and tweak the particle color to make the effect more visible and dynamic. The final result will give the illusion of many particles with just a few.

Additional Notes: This technique is especially useful for optimizing your effects when performance is a concern, as it reduces the number of particles used in your scene while still achieving a full and rich effect. By combining material manipulation and texture tricks, you can create a complex-looking particle system with minimal resource usage. The use of Photoshop for texture generation adds another level of customization to your effects, making them more unique and dynamic.
